Greatest Hits is the first greatest hits compilation for the Jackson 5 released by Motown Records in late 1971, and selling over 5. 6 million copies worldwide. The Top 10 hit single Sugar Daddy is included as a new track alongside J5 hits such as I Want You Back and I'll Be There. Side One. I Want You Back. Never Can Say Goodbye. Sugar Daddy recorded April October 1971, during Maybe Tomorrow & Lookin Through the Windows sessions, at the Motown Recording Studio, Los Angeles.
